Area information The area has plenty of opportunities for outdoor pursuits, such as walking in Killarney's National Park, mountain hiking, touring, fishing, cycling on car-free routes, canoeing, surfing and horse-riding.
42 golf courses, including 10 seaside links, are located within a 2-hour drive of the guest house.

- Castle Lodge is located in Killarney town centre, at the beginning of Muckross Road (N71).
- Castle Lodge is the first guest house on the right-hand side of the road after the traffic lights, towards Kenmare / Muckross House.
